Suriya and Jyotika's home production 'Oh My Dog' to release on April 21

South film star Suriya on Wednesday announced that his home production film 'Oh My Dog' will release on April 21. The family entertainer is written-directed by

Sarov Shanmuga

and produced by the star couple Suriya and Jyotika under their banner 2D Entertainment.

The Tamil-language film brings together three generations of the real-life film family (grandfather-father-son trio) - Vijaykumar, Arun Vijay, and Arnav Vijay, who makes his debut as an actor, according to a press release from the streamer.

'Oh My Dog' is a heartwarming tale about Arjun (Arnav) and a blind puppy Simba.

"It's a film that every child and family will love to watch, enjoy and relate to; the plot delves into their world of desires, priorities, caring, courage, victory, disappointments, friendship, sacrifice, unconditional love and loyalty," the official plotline read.

Suriya shared the news of the film's release date in a post on Twitter.

"Oreo, Waffle, Jo and I, bring to you #OhMyDogOnPrime a film from our hearts to yours, on 21 April @PrimeVideoIN #ArnavVijay #Simba @arunvijayno1," the 46-year-old actor wrote.

The streaming platform also shared the news on its official social media handle.

'Oh My Dog' will exclusively premiere in Tamil and

Telugu

across India as well as 240 other countries and territories on the streaming service.
